In California, the Department of Social Services (for assisted living facilities) and the Department of Public Health (for nursing homes) conduct inspections to ensure resident safety and regulatory compliance.

Inspection Report Summary for Sierra Vista Independent & Assisted Living
The Sierra Vista Residential Care Facility for the Elderly, located at 13815 Rodeo Drive, Victorville, California, was subject to two recent Community Care Licensing Division inspections. The first, a pre‑licensing visit conducted on September 30 2024 by LPAs Mary Rico and Eldin Serrano, reviewed the pending ownership transfer. The inspectors toured the 50 bedrooms, 44 bathrooms, kitchen, dining area, and courtyard, confirming that all resident spaces were properly furnished, sanitary, and equipped with required safety devices. Medical and food storage practices, temperature controls, and emergency equipment met state standards, and no deficiencies were noted. The report was signed and delivered to Administrator Kimberly Mejia, and the facility received a clean pre‑licensing assessment.
A year later, on September 22 2025, an unannounced annual inspection by LPA Eldin Serrano identified several areas of noncompliance. While the physical plant remained in good condition and resident rooms were appropriately furnished, the facility failed to maintain an updated earthquake drill, prompting a Type A technical violation. Additionally, the absence of a 72‑hour emergency food and water supply and incomplete staff documentation—specifically a missing food‑handler training certificate and a TB health screening for staff member #6—resulted in three citations under Title 22, Division 6. The inspectors confirmed that fire extinguishers, smoke detectors, and carbon monoxide alarms were functional, and that personnel health screening requirements were not fully met. The report included detailed plans of correction and highlighted the necessity of addressing these deficiencies within the agency’s specified timeframe.
Across both inspections, the facility demonstrates overall compliance with most health, safety, and operational standards, but recurring documentation gaps—particularly in emergency preparedness and staff credentialing—emerge as notable patterns. The pre‑licensing clean audit underscores Sierra Vista’s readiness to transition ownership, while the subsequent annual findings emphasize the importance of maintaining up‑to‑date records and preparedness protocols to safeguard resident well‑being and regulatory adherence.
